Detailed explanation-1: -Consumers are people who buy or use goods and services to satisfy their wants. When you eat your dinner, you will be a consumer. You’ll be hungry and eating a meal will make you feel full. You’ll be a consumer of food. You are also a consumer when you go to school.

Detailed explanation-2: -A society’s economy is based on creating wealth through selling and buying. The people who do the selling and buying are producers and consumers. Producers create, or produce, goods and provide services, and consumers buy those goods and services with money. Most people are both producers and consumers.

Detailed explanation-3: -Many economists believe in consumer sovereignty. Simply put, this means that consumers are the main drivers in deciding what goods and services will be produced in any given market. In most cases, producers won’t bring things to the market unless they are filling a demand from consumers.
